Role Summary :
We are looking for a skilled Automotive Mechanic specializing in Japanese and Korean vehicles to join our team.
The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ience diagnosing, repairing, and maintaining brands like Toyota, Honda, Nissan, Hyundai, Kia, and Mitsubishi.
Responsibilities :
Diagnose and repair mechanical and electrical issues in Japanese and Korean vehicles.
Perform routine maintenance, including oil changes, brake repairs, engine diagnostics, and suspension work.
Conduct engine and transmission repairs.
Troubleshoot and repair electrical and fuel system problems.
Ensure all repairs meet manufacturer and industry standards.
Use diagnostic tools to detect faults and recommend solutions.
Maintain a clean and organized workspace.
Advise customers on necessary repairs and maintenance.
Requirements :
5 – 7 years hands-on proven experience as an automotive mechanic, preferably with Japanese and Korean brands.
Bachelor’s Degree :
Strong knowledge of engines, transmissions, brakes, and suspension systems.
Ability to use diagnostic tools and repair software.
Technical certification in automotive repair (preferred).
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Good communication skills and customer service mindset.
